//===-- swift-demangle.cpp - Swift Demangler app ---------------------------===//
//
// This source file is part of the Swift.org open source project
//
// Copyright (c) 2014 - 2015 Apple Inc. and the Swift project authors
// Licensed under Apache License v2.0 with Runtime Library Exception
//
// See http://swift.org/LICENSE.txt for license information
// See http://swift.org/CONTRIBUTORS.txt for the list of Swift project authors
//
//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
//
// This is the entry point.
//
//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
#include "swift/Basic/DemangleWrappers.h"
#include "llvm/Support/CommandLine.h"
#include "llvm/Support/MemoryBuffer.h"
#include "llvm/Support/PrettyStackTrace.h"
#include "llvm/Support/Regex.h"
#include "llvm/Support/Signals.h"
#include "llvm/Support/raw_ostream.h"
#include <string>
static llvm::cl::opt<bool>
ExpandMode("expand",
llvm::cl::desc("Expand mode (show node structure of the demangling)"));
static llvm::cl::opt<bool>
CompactMode("compact",
llvm::cl::desc("Compact mode (only emit the demangled names)"));
static llvm::cl::opt<bool>
TreeOnly("tree-only",
llvm::cl::desc("Tree-only mode (do not show the demangled string)"));
static llvm::cl::opt<bool>
RemangleMode("test-remangle",
llvm::cl::desc("Remangle test mode (show the remangled string)"));
static llvm::cl::opt<bool>
DisableSugar("no-sugar",
llvm::cl::desc("No sugar mode (disable common language idioms such as ? and [] from the output)"));
static llvm::cl::opt<bool>
Simplified("simplified",
llvm::cl::desc("Don't display module names or implicit self types"));
static llvm::cl::list<std::string>
InputNames(llvm::cl::Positional, llvm::cl::desc("[mangled name...]"),
llvm::cl::ZeroOrMore);
static void demangle(llvm::raw_ostream &os, llvm::StringRef name,
const swift::Demangle::DemangleOptions &options) {
bool hadLeadingUnderscore = false;
if (name.startswith("__")) {
hadLeadingUnderscore = true;
name = name.substr(1);
}
swift::Demangle::NodePointer pointer =
swift::demangle_wrappers::demangleSymbolAsNode(name);
if (ExpandMode || TreeOnly) {
llvm::outs() << "Demangling for " << name << '\n';
swift::demangle_wrappers::NodeDumper(pointer).print(llvm::outs());
}
if (RemangleMode) {
if (hadLeadingUnderscore) llvm::outs() << '_';
// Just reprint the original mangled name if it didn't demangle.
// This makes it easier to share the same database between the
// mangling and demangling tests.
if (!pointer) {
llvm::outs() << name;
} else {
llvm::outs() << swift::Demangle::mangleNode(pointer);
}
return;
}
if (!TreeOnly) {
std::string string = swift::Demangle::nodeToString(pointer, options);
if (!CompactMode)
llvm::outs() << name << " ---> ";
llvm::outs() << (string.empty() ? name : llvm::StringRef(string));
}
}
static llvm::StringRef substrBefore(llvm::StringRef whole,
llvm::StringRef part) {
return whole.slice(0, part.data() - whole.data());
}
static llvm::StringRef substrAfter(llvm::StringRef whole,
llvm::StringRef part) {
return whole.substr((part.data() - whole.data()) + part.size());
}
int main(int argc, char **argv) {
llvm::cl::ParseCommandLineOptions(argc, argv);
swift::Demangle::DemangleOptions options;
options.SynthesizeSugarOnTypes = !DisableSugar;
if (Simplified)
options = swift::Demangle::DemangleOptions::SimplifiedUIDemangleOptions();
if (InputNames.empty()) {
CompactMode = true;
auto input = llvm::MemoryBuffer::getSTDIN();
if (!input) {
llvm::errs() << input.getError().message() << '\n';
return EXIT_FAILURE;
}
llvm::StringRef inputContents = input.get()->getBuffer();
// This doesn't handle Unicode symbols, but maybe that's okay.
llvm::Regex maybeSymbol("_T[_a-zA-Z0-9$]+");
llvm::SmallVector<llvm::StringRef, 1> matches;
while (maybeSymbol.match(inputContents, &matches)) {
llvm::outs() << substrBefore(inputContents, matches.front());
demangle(llvm::outs(), matches.front(), options);
inputContents = substrAfter(inputContents, matches.front());
}
llvm::outs() << inputContents;
} else {
for (llvm::StringRef name : InputNames) {
demangle(llvm::outs(), name, options);
llvm::outs() << '\n';
}
}
return EXIT_SUCCESS;
}
